Which Headlight Conversion Is Brightest for the Chevy S10

When it comes to upgrading the headlights on your Chevy S-10, the debate between sticking with halogen or making the jump to LED is one of the most common discussions among owners. Whether you drive a first-gen square-body or a second-gen rounded model, the factory lighting on these trucks is notoriously dim by today's standards. Upgrading isn't just about style—it's about safety and visibility on dark roads. But which option actually delivers the brightest, most usable light for your dollar? Let's break it down.

First, let's look at the standard halogen setup. The S-10 originally came with sealed beam units or composite housings using 9004 or 9007 halogen bulbs. These produce a warm, yellowish light that typically outputs around 1,000 to 1,200 lumens on low beam. The technology is simple: a tungsten filament heats up and glows, producing light as a byproduct of heat. The advantage? Halogens are cheap, widely available, and have a predictable beam pattern when used with factory reflectors. However, they are inefficient—roughly 80% of their energy is wasted as heat. They also suffer from significant lumen depreciation over time, meaning your already dim headlights get even dimmer as the bulbs age.

Now enter LEDs. A quality LED conversion bulb for the S-10 can produce anywhere from 3,000 to over 5,000 lumens per bulb, often tripling the raw output of a new halogen. Instead of a glowing filament, LEDs use semiconductors that emit light when electricity passes through them. This allows for a crisp, pure white light (typically 5000K to 6000K color temperature) that closely mimics daylight. That color temperature is crucial—it reduces eye strain and increases contrast, making obstacles like potholes, debris, or animals much easier to spot at speed. On paper, LEDs are unquestionably “brighter.” Chevy S10

However, raw lumen numbers don't tell the whole story. Brightness is useless if the light isn't aimed correctly. Here lies the biggest pitfall for S-10 owners. The stock reflector housings are designed specifically for the 360-degree light emission of a halogen bulb. When you drop an LED bulb into that same housing, the light source often comes from two or three small chips positioned on a flat blade. This does not mimic the filament location perfectly. As a result, the light scatters improperly, creating hot spots directly in front of the truck while leaving the sides and distance poorly lit. Worse, that scattered light blinds oncoming traffic, making your “bright” upgrade a hazard to others. If you choose LEDs, you absolutely must adjust your Chevy S10 headlight aim downward and consider installing projector housings designed for LED or HID bulbs to maintain a sharp cutoff line.

Beyond raw output, consider the beam pattern and distance. Halogens, despite being dimmer, tend to produce a longer, narrower throw of light down the road because their reflectors are optimized for that specific light source. LEDs produce a wide, flood-like beam that illuminates the foreground beautifully but may struggle to reach as far unless paired with high-quality optics. For highway driving at 60 mph, distance matters more than width. A well-aimed halogen setup can sometimes outshine a poorly designed LED kit in long-range visibility, even if the LED seems brighter in a parking lot.

Reliability is another factor. Halogen bulbs generate extreme heat inside the engine bay, which can degrade wiring and connectors over time—a known issue on aging S-10s. LEDs, conversely, run much cooler at the diode, though they do require heat sinks or fans on the back of the bulb to dissipate heat from the driver module. This can be a problem in tight S-10 headlight buckets, as the bulky heatsink may not fit without modifying the dust cap or trimming the housing. Furthermore, cheap, non-resistor LEDs can cause hyper-flash or flickering because the S-10's electrical system expects the lower resistance of a halogen bulb.

So, which is genuinely “brightest”? If we define brightness purely by lumens and color clarity, LEDs win decisively. A premium LED kit from a reputable brand can produce nearly four times the light output of a fresh halogen. But if we define brightness as “effective, usable illumination that doesn't blind others and reaches far down the road,” the answer becomes murky. A halogen bulb with a fresh, high-output upgrade (like a 9007 SilverStar Ultra) in a clean, properly aimed housing will often outperform a cheap LED drop-in that scatters light everywhere.

For most S-10 daily drivers, the sweet spot is this: invest in new, high-quality halogen bulbs and install a heavy-duty relay harness that draws power directly from the battery. This bypasses the old, resistive factory wiring and delivers full voltage to the bulbs, often increasing halogen output by 30% without any glare issues. If you truly want LEDs, pair them with aftermarket projector headlight housings specifically designed for LED technology. This combination gives you the raw brightness advantage without sacrificing beam control.

Ultimately, the brightest headlight is the one that lets you see clearly while keeping you legal and safe. For a budget restoration, stick with halogens and a relay. For a modern overhaul, go with a full projector-LED conversion. But never drop LEDs into old reflectors and call it a day—you'll be the brightest nuisance on the road, not the best-lit driver.
